'State of the Union Addresses by United States Presidents (1970 - 1974)' Summary
This compilation presents President Richard Nixon's annual State of the Union addresses delivered between 1970 and 1974. Each address offers a comprehensive overview of Nixon's perception of the nation's condition, highlighting key areas of concern and outlining his legislative agenda. Through these speeches, Nixon addresses critical issues such as the Vietnam War, domestic unrest, economic challenges, and the evolving Cold War landscape. He outlines his policy approaches and appeals for cooperation from Congress to achieve his objectives. The book provides a valuable historical document, capturing Nixon's perspective on the challenges facing the nation and his vision for its future during a pivotal period in American history.Book Details
